        Product Description

        Treat yourself to a quick, reviving five-minute hair mask. Moroccanoil® Intense Hydrating Mask is a high-performance, rich and creamy deep conditioner formulated for medium to thick, dry hair. Infused with antioxidant-rich argan oil and nourishing ingredients, it hydrates and conditions while dramatically improving hair's texture, elasticity, shine and manageability.

        How to use: Apply a generous amount of Moroccanoil® Intense Hydrating Mask to towel-dried hair and comb through. Leave on for 5-7 minutes and rinse thoroughly. No heat required. Use 1-2 times weekly.

        How should I properly shampoo and condition my hair?
        You might think you know how to wash your hair, but there are a few little tricks that can make a huge difference. The secret is to focus shampoo on your scalp, conditioner on your ends, and use the right water temperature.

        How Can I Reduce Frizz?
        Frizz is usually a sign that your hair is thirsty. The best ways to reduce it are to keep your hair hydrated, use gentle products and tools, and protect it from things that cause damage, like heat and friction.
